Transaction ebc01a5e641eb347fc922862eeb3b6c2ce977ec289375f9ecc13fe80f2bb20b9

89 Input
2 Outputs
  • ebc01a5e641eb347fc922862eeb3b6c2ce977ec289375f9ecc13fe80f2bb20b9:0
  • value  19000000
    address  372cz75EmfycSuowhYYXE4eeNfdom3rPwJ
  • ebc01a5e641eb347fc922862eeb3b6c2ce977ec289375f9ecc13fe80f2bb20b9:1
  • value  424195
    address  3E8FipgPvLoKkbkoxYf5WjcF2pB4c5Yrzt